Blockchain
BNB Chain, the branded blockchain deployed by the world’s prime crypto change, was halted earlier at the moment in response to a debilitating bridge hack value some $566 million.
That determine was ultimately lowered to only $100 million because of fast coordination amongst BNB Chain’s 26 validators, 19 of which got here collectively to halt the chain earlier than the hacker(s) may efficiently smuggle a lot of the stolen crypto out of the Binance ecosystem.
Validators pushed an replace hours later and introduced the community again on-line.
In contrast to Bitcoin and Ethereum, which each characteristic 1000’s — and even tens of 1000’s — of community contributors all working collectively to course of transactions, BNB Chain strategically determined for a extra centralized construction with far fewer people in cost.
BNB Chain’s “proof-of-staked authority” echoes many different consensus types employed by blockchains, akin to EOS’ “delegated proof-of-stake.”
In commonplace proof-of-stake programs, token holders are given extra energy relying on the worth of tokens of their wallets; in Binance’s case, BNB token holders use their balances to elect to trusted third events.
This awards validators each profitable revenues related to holding the community working easily and whole efficient management over the performance of the community (though there are penalties for working out of bounds).
Usually, fewer validators enable for greater throughput: It takes for much longer for information to seep via a community consisting of 1000’s of nodes than it does for 2 dozen servers to agree on which transactions to approve.
There’s additionally arguably a much more vital advantage of such a smaller set of community validators: It’s a lot simpler to coordinate between them and thus exert management over the community, as we’ve now seen.
Binance nonetheless in a position to exert management over its blockchain
Binance was fast to laud its capacity to coordinate between its validators and change off the community, regardless of some extent of chaos triggered throughout its DeFi apps, which presently have $5.45 billion in digital belongings in play.
Blockchain engineer Zak Cole, chief know-how officer at Web3 buying and selling platform Slingshot Finance, discovered the velocity at which Binance was in a position to band its validators collectively to droop operations regarding.
“It’s form of sketchy. I imply, halting a change ought to require an enormous quantity of coordination between disparate validators and ideally, for the sake of censorship prevention, you don’t actually know who the validators are.”
Blockworks has reached out to most of the 19 validators concerned in halting the community to be taught extra concerning the course of, and can replace this piece as we hear again.
Coinbase, whose Cloud division maintains a BNB Chain validator, directed us to a weblog put up, which mentioned that it was in a position to coordinate between community validators by contacting all of them individually (“one after the other”) and lauded its capacity to achieve consensus regardless of its elected stewards working in numerous time zones.
This implies a easy group chat wasn’t concerned, with the wording of Binance’s put up indicating that every validator was inspired to halt the chain with out enter from the others.
“I believe it simply nods in the direction of centralization, that any individual can ship a message to some group and basically shut down a blockchain. I don’t know if that meets the definition of a blockchain by my requirements,” Cole mentioned.
One may argue that Binance opted for a smaller validator set to make it simpler to navigate excessive circumstances akin to hacks and different safety incidents, nonetheless Cole highlighted that ease of coordination will not be written into the codebase: These results are purely social.
BNB Chain is reasonable, very low-cost
With this in thoughts, Binance on this case is considerably extra akin to a tech firm than a standard blockchain community — nearly like Fb deciding to take the positioning down for upkeep.
Cole introduced up the Ethereum ecosystem’s prolonged debate over emergency measures following The DAO hack in 2016, during which $60 million in ether was stolen.
That course of took weeks of significant decision-making, Cole famous, with Ethereum contributors ultimately deciding to rollback the chain by way of a tough fork (not a sequence halt), permitting the transactions to be undone and stolen cash returned to The DAO traders.
Such a course of is a mirrored image of the variety of community contributors concerned in Ethereum governance when in comparison with Binance.
“I believe the upper the variety of separate contributors, the higher off when it comes to decentralization. Such a low validator set [with BNB Chain], I believe, is form of inherently insecure,” Cole mentioned.
So, what would it not take to decentralize BNB Chain? Cole advised permitting anybody to run a validator and take part in consensus, no matter whether or not they’re elected, just like the purely permissionless nature of Ethereum and Bitcoin.
However Cole expressed that BNB Chain boasts a barely totally different use case: It’s a centralized chain constructed to be less expensive than Ethereum. Anybody can deploy a contract — and thus launch a token — on BNB Chain and start promoting it to degens throughout lots of of BNB-powered Uniswap forks.
It’s equally true that anybody can deploy tokens on Ethereum and promote them on the precise Uniswap. However on BNB Chain, it prices a fraction of a cent versus {dollars}, making it cheaper by a magnitude of 100 no less than.
“Individuals are making selections based mostly on efficiency, safety and decentralization, they usually’re selecting efficiency over decentralization,” Cole mentioned. “I don’t suppose that presents a big worth proposition essentially.”